§§5215, 5216. Repealed. Pub. L. 101–624, title XV, §1571, Nov. 28, 1990, 104 Stat. 3702

Section 5215, Pub. L. 100–418, title IV, §4205, Aug. 23, 1988, 102 Stat. 1392, authorized Secretary of Agriculture to contract with individuals for services to be performed outside United States. See section 5673 of this title.

Section 5216, Pub. L. 100–418, title IV, §4206, Aug. 23, 1988, 102 Stat. 1392, provided for establishment of a trade assistance office within Foreign Agricultural Service.
